Good news Larionov re-signs with Wings The Detroit Red Wings agreed to terms of a one-year contract with center Igor Larionov. Larionov, the oldest player in the NHL at 41, had 11 goals, 32 assists in 70 regular-season games last season for the Stanley Cup champions .
